  1. Child marriage refers to all marriages or unions in which one or both spouses are under the age of 18 and or were not able to give their free and informed consent. On this page all types of child, early and forced marriages and unions are referred to as child marriage as this is the commonly used term.

  2. Child marriage is a marriage or domestic partnership, formal or informal, usually between a child and an adult, but can also be between a child and another child. [1] Although the age of majority (legal adulthood) and marriage age are typically 18 years old, these thresholds can differ in different jurisdictions. [2]
